Understanding Industrial Noise Pollution and Its Impact
Industrial noise pollution is a significant concern in manufacturing and warehousing facilities. The constant hum, rumble, and clatter from machinery, vehicles, and heavy equipment can create an oppressive work environment for employees and negatively impact their health and well-being. Prolonged exposure to high levels of industrial noise has been linked to hearing loss, stress, and even cardiovascular issues. It disrupts concentration, hinders communication, and can lead to decreased productivity.
